Luminescence and scintillation characteristics of YAG:Ce single crystalline films and single crystals

The detailed comparative analysis of luminescent and scintillation properties of the single crystalline films (SCF) of YAG:Ce garnet grown from melt-solutions based on the traditional PbO-based and novel BaO-based fluxes, and of a YAG:Ce bulk single crystal grown from the melt by the Czochralski method, was performed in this work. Using the ~(241)Am (α-particle, 5.49 MeV) excitation we show that scintillation yield and energy resolution of the optimized YAG:Ce SCF is fully comparable with that of the YAG:Ce single crystal analogue.
机译:YAG:Ce石榴石单晶膜(SCF)的发光和闪烁特性的详细比较分析,该单晶膜是从基于传统PbO基和新型BaO基助熔剂的熔体溶液中生长的YAG:Ce石榴石,以及YAG:Ce块状单晶在这项工作中进行了通过切克劳斯基方法从熔体中生长的过程。使用〜(241)Am(α粒子,5.49 MeV)激发,我们表明,优化的YAG:Ce SCF的闪烁产率和能量分辨率与YAG:Ce单晶类似物的闪烁产率和能量分辨率完全可比。
